Transaction 609b37912211afe2eb61f88319b7ca666667c565ac0b1d5bfaaf5bbe669a9d30
1 Input
1 Output
-
609b37912211afe2eb61f88319b7ca666667c565ac0b1d5bfaaf5bbe669a9d30:0
- value
- 1508230
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4a1bf4125748d93c4e033033dc460c4148b3919b OP_EQUAL
- address
- 38SsQyYvghTvAST49j6GXnuygmz2YqKGb2